GT: Nets(23-23) vs. Magic (19-25) 1/18/19 7:00pm EST
Getting to .500 was a goal. Now comes the hard part. Getting above it.
The Magic are not to be slept on. Their frontcourt has given us trouble, so we need Jarrett Allen to pick up where he left off from his dominant performance the other night versus Houston.
Don't be shocked to see Graham defending Gordon. I'm rooting for the dude to keep up the momentum. if he can knock down his shots like he did versus Houston, watch out.
RHJ is also back so lets hope he can get his game going defensively and on the boards.
Dinwiddie did massive heavy lifting the other game, so D'Angelo needs to wreck these dudes while having another clean game assist to turnover wise.
Nets are -1 favorites, the O/U is 217. I think i'm taking the over, what about you?
